
Citizens of Kyrgyzstan should be especially cautious when purchasing land plots, as warned by the State Service for Land and Water Management. Recently, there has been an increase in cases of fraud in the land market. Buyers often rely on verbal assurances about the possibility of construction, which later turn out to be unfounded.
In reality, it turns out that the purchased plots may be classified as agricultural land, which excludes the possibility of constructing residential buildings. The agency reminds that land use must comply with the established intended purpose, and failure to adhere to these norms can lead to serious legal and financial consequences.
To avoid falling into the trap of fraudsters, it is recommended to follow several tips before making a purchase:
Clarify the official intended purpose of the plot;Request information from the relevant government authorities;Thoroughly check all documents confirming ownership rights and permits.
